Subject: DR drill Friday — tide-table widget

Friday, 09:00. We simulate full loss of the Moonpull tide-table widget backend. You restore the prediction cache from the Saltgrave cold store; I handle DNS failover. Expect the harbor charts to render stale data for ~20 minutes — that's fine, note it and move on. Keep the timeline doc open and timestamp every step. Don't improvise; follow the runbook order exactly. The cold store is sealed, so you'll need the recovery passphrase, which is given directly below.

unlock words, bawig-tagef: silael-sorir-gilys-rusox-aldion-novvan-norir-silmir-gilion-rusiel-soreth-fraax-novys-rusok

Subject: On-call intro — LiftSim dispatcher

Welcome to the rotation. You'll be covering LiftSim, our elevator-dispatch simulator used by the Hallway Dynamics team for capacity testing. Most pages come from stuck simulation runs: check the run queue first, then restart the coordinator if runs are older than 30 minutes. Escalate to the platform channel if the coordinator itself is unresponsive. The full triage steps and restart commands are on the runbook page here.

operations page: https://jenkins.zemvarcloud.local/job/merge_requests/repo/build/73930b4b30f0a8ed

## Crash-Report Pipeline: Restart Procedure

Welcome aboard. The Fenroth crash-report pipeline ingests symbolicated reports from the Quellit mobile apps and fans them out to the triage store. If the ingest worker stalls, first confirm the upstream collector is healthy, then drain the dead-letter queue before restarting — restarting with a full queue will duplicate reports. Symbolication caches live on the attached volume and must not be wiped. After any restart, verify the worker loads its runtime settings, which are listed below for reference.

service settings:
BELYS_PIN=8148
BELYS_TENANT=lamius
BELYS_METRICS_HOST=metrics.belys.tolvaqlabs.internal
BELYS_SEAL=seal_dc8ee71f
BELYS_STANDBY_TEAM=praix